What a Thread Lift Does Best

A thread lift uses absorbable sutures, such as PDO or PCL threads, to create a mechanical lift by physically pulling sagging skin and tissue upward. This is most effective for individuals with mild to moderate tissue laxity in areas like the cheeks, jawline, and brows.

The benefits are two-fold:

  • Immediate Mechanical Lift: The threads provide an instant, visible lift by repositioning tissues.

  • Collagen Stimulation: The threads also act as a scaffold, triggering the body's natural healing response and stimulating new collagen production, which improves skin quality and firmness over time. The results can last 12 to 24 months or longer, depending on the thread type used.

What Dermal Fillers Address

Dermal fillers are injectable gels, most commonly made of hyaluronic acid (HA), designed to replace lost volume, smooth out static wrinkles, and enhance facial contours. They are ideal when the appearance of aging is primarily due to deflation rather than descent.

Common treatment areas for fillers include cheeks, nasolabial folds, lips, and under-eye hollows. Key characteristics of fillers are:

  • Immediate Results: The volumising effect is visible right away.

  • Minimal Downtime: Recovery is typically quick, with most patients returning to normal activities immediately.

  • Reversibility: Hyaluronic acid fillers can be dissolved if needed, offering a safety net not available with threads.

The Most Common Mistake: Mismatching the Method

A common error is choosing the wrong treatment for the primary concern. Using only a thread lift on someone with significant volume loss can result in a face that looks "tight but empty". Conversely, using only fillers on someone with true tissue sagging can weigh the face down, creating a heavy or overfilled look without correcting the underlying laxity. When to Combine Both Treatments

For many patients, the answer is not a single treatment but a combination. A thread lift and dermal fillers are often used together to address both sagging and volume loss, creating a more comprehensive and natural rejuvenation. A typical staged approach involves first using threads to lift and support the underlying tissue, followed by fillers to restore volume and refine contours once the lift has settled. This combination approach is often the most effective way to achieve a balanced, youthful look.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I get both a thread lift and fillers?

Yes, combining them is common. Threads provide lift, while fillers restore volume, addressing multiple signs of ageing together.

Which lasts longer, threads or fillers?

Thread effects can last 12-24 months, while fillers typically last 6-18 months. Longevity depends on the product used and individual factors.

Are thread lifts more invasive than fillers?

Yes. Threads require a slightly longer recovery with more swelling and bruising compared to fillers, which generally have minimal downtime.

How do I know if I need a lift or volume?

If your face looks saggy with good volume, a thread lift is better. If it looks hollow or deflated, fillers are likely the answer. A practitioner can assess this.
